All star weekend was hit and miss. The Skills was decent, Dunk contest was awful, as was the 3 point contest. All Star Game was great though, AD with 52 for the new record.

Also, the big news is of course, DeMarcus Coursins + Omri Casspi are traded to the New Orleans Pelicans. Kings will receive Buddy Hield, Tyreke Evans, Langston Galloway, a 2017 1st Round Pick, and a 2017 2nd Round Pick.

So the Pelicans suddenly have a front court of DeMarcus Cousins and Anthony Davis. Absolutely monstrous front. Sets up an interesting possibility that if the Pelicans finish in 8th seed, which they're 2.5 games back on, the Warriors will face Boogie and AD. What a thought eh :tongue:
